Lord, I've believed that boundaries are selfish, that loving others means depleting myself, that saying "no" equals failing you. I've exhausted myself trying to meet every need, fulfill every expectation, be everything to everyone. I'm tired, resentful, and running on empty.
Give me permission to establish healthy boundaries - to say "no" without guilt, to protect my capacity without shame, to care for myself as well as I care for others. Help me discern what's mine to carry and what isn't, what I'm called to do and what I need to release to others. Teach me to serve from overflow rather than depletion, from fullness rather than empty obligation. You gave me this one life to steward well. Help me guard it wisely so I can give it generously.
